From f25b0e709f6be1dfa6e56c9c54985fb0292d0fd0 Mon Sep 17 00:00:00 2001
From: Charlene Liu <charlene.liu@amd.com>
Date: Wed, 19 Dec 2018 13:47:19 -0500
Subject: [PATCH 1080/2940] drm/amd/display: dp interlace MSA timing
 programming for Interlace mode.

[Why]
DP compliance box shows wrong MSA data.

Signed-off-by: Charlene Liu <charlene.liu@amd.com>
Reviewed-by: Jun Lei <Jun.Lei@amd.com>
Acked-by: Leo Li <sunpeng.li@amd.com>
Signed-off-by: Alex Deucher <alexander.deucher@amd.com>
---
 .../amd/display/dc/dce/dce_stream_encoder.c   | 63 +++++++++--------
 .../display/dc/dcn10/dcn10_stream_encoder.c   | 68 +++++++++++--------
 2 files changed, 76 insertions(+), 55 deletions(-)

diff --git a/drivers/gpu/drm/amd/display/dc/dce/dce_stream_encoder.c b/drivers/gpu/drm/amd/display/dc/dce/dce_stream_encoder.c
index f372af3c833c..92c398c3d21a 100644
--- a/drivers/gpu/drm/amd/display/dc/dce/dce_stream_encoder.c
+++ b/drivers/gpu/drm/amd/display/dc/dce/dce_stream_encoder.c
@@ -288,9 +288,18 @@ static void dce110_stream_encoder_dp_set_stream_attribute(
 #endif
 
 	struct dce110_stream_encoder *enc110 = DCE110STRENC_FROM_STRENC(enc);
-
+	struct dc_crtc_timing hw_crtc_timing = *crtc_timing;
+	if (hw_crtc_timing.flags.INTERLACE) {
+		/*the input timing is in VESA spec format with Interlace flag =1*/
+		hw_crtc_timing.v_total /= 2;
+		hw_crtc_timing.v_border_top /= 2;
+		hw_crtc_timing.v_addressable /= 2;
+		hw_crtc_timing.v_border_bottom /= 2;
+		hw_crtc_timing.v_front_porch /= 2;
+		hw_crtc_timing.v_sync_width /= 2;
+	}
